Everpure to Join S&P 500 Index in Quarterly Rebalance
Key Facts
In a move reflecting the rapid evolution of the technology and data storage sector, Everpure has announced its official inclusion in the S&P 500 index. According to reports, the inclusion will become effective prior to the opening of trading on Monday, September 21, 2026. This decision comes as part of a quarterly index rebalance, confirming that the company has met the rigorous eligibility criteria, including market capitalization, liquidity, and financial performance.
This listing reflects growing confidence in Everpure's strategy, particularly as enterprises race to make their data AI-ready. According to analysts, inclusion in the benchmark index typically drives institutional buying from passive funds that track the index.
